"The International Criminal Court issued an arrest warrant for Sudanese President Umar al-Bashir over his alleged role in crimes against humanity and war crimes in the western region of Darfur." See the Bloomberg.com article
The Flint Area Women's Missionary Society supports My Sister's Keeper, a humanitarian action group that is "focused on assisting, protecting, and advocating for" the women of the Sudan, encouraging their educational, economic, and physical enrichment.

Fundraising for My Sisters Keeper
At the Flint Area WMS meeting in October, I asked that we as an Area, collect dimes (and other change) to donate to MSK. In the next couple of months we could potentially raise $5000.
Each local society is also asked to develop a fundraiser for MSK in addition to collecting dimes. Vernon Chapel and Bethel-Saginaw have both had very successful stay-at-home teas. Local presidents were e-mailed "71 Ways to Fundraise for the WMS," from our Conference treasurer, Orletta Caldwell. Remember, all funds collected should be sent to the Area (chairperson or financial secretary) for recording and then we will pass them on.
2nd Vice Presidents (area and Local) will oversee our Global Mission efforts.
